Recent developments have led to speculation that the United States may get involved in the war between Israel and Iran. As tensions rise in the Middle East, former US President Donald Trump took to his social media platform, Truth Social, and wrote: “Everyone should immediately evacuate Tehran.” The message has triggered fresh concerns of an escalation in the region.
Trump also wrote, “We now have complete and total control of the skies over Iran. Iran had good sky trackers and other defensive equipment, and plenty of it, but it doesn’t compare to American made, conceived, and manufactured ‘stuff.’ Nobody does it better than the good ol’ USA.”

These remarks came after Trump left the ongoing G7 Summit in Canada and returned to Washington. French President Emmanuel Macron claimed Trump left the summit to work on a ceasefire between Israel and Iran. Trump dismissed this, calling Macron “publicity seeking” and saying, “Wrong! He has no idea why I am now on my way.”

Meanwhile, reports indicate that the U.S. has deployed the USS Nimitz aircraft carrier to the region, and refuelling aircraft closer to the conflict zone. While the U.S. claims it is a defensive move, the timing indicates a higher level of alert.



Though the U.S. has not made any formal announcement about joining the war, Trump’s recent statements, the presence of U.S. troops in the region, and the evacuation alert have increased speculation over whether the U.S. is preparing to enter the conflict in support of Israel. - TWL Bureau
